What is SCADA? • SCADA is a term for a type of system. The acronym stands for Supervisory Control And Data Acquisition • SCADA is a control system used to monitor and control operation of equipment such as pumps, valves, sensors and other instruments. How to fund SCADA projects? Obsolescence • SCADA software upgrade cycle is typically 5 years • Hardware lifecycle is typically 15 -20 years Master Plans • Either overall or SCADA Master Plans can help justify • Are a formal document identifying a need and path • Master Plans typically have a list of projects Automation Committee CIP Planning • Identify SCADA needs in advance • Add the costs for SCADA projects to the CIP FSAWWA 2018 Fall Conference

How to fund SCADA projects? Add-on Strategies • Take advantage of plant expansions or refurbishments • Add fiber optic cable when installing underground assets like pipelines • Follow the IT model and specify the right equipment and software Justifications • • • Improve safety Downtime or spill costs versus more instrumentation and visibility Go from 24/7/365 to only M-F 8 -5 operators Remote visibility/control for all Reduce energy and maintenance costs Automation Committee FSAWWA 2018 Fall Conference
